GPU Optimization Techniques Applied to Scale Free Gene Regulatory Networks Based on Threshold Function

  • Vinícius Vilar Jacob Universidade Federal de Viçosa
  • Chaulio de Resende Ferreira Universidade Federal de Viçosa
  • Ricardo Ferreira Universidade Federal de Viçosa


This paper describes the use of GPU-specific optimization techniques applied to the problem of simulation of scale free gene regulatory networks based on threshold function on GPU. We made attempts to optimize memory access, change the data structure used to represent the graph, use of stream and ILP (Instruction Level Parallelism) on the implementation made in an earlier work by Campos et al (2011). The optimizations that showed more effectiveness were the change in the representation of the graph, ILP and stream with speedup up to 5.99 times over the previous approach which was also done on GPU.
Palavras-chave: Graphics processing units, Instruction sets, Kernel, Optimization, Data structures, Biological system modeling, Hardware
JACOB, Vinícius Vilar; FERREIRA, Chaulio de Resende; FERREIRA, Ricardo. GPU Optimization Techniques Applied to Scale Free Gene Regulatory Networks Based on Threshold Function. In: SIMPÓSIO EM SISTEMAS COMPUTACIONAIS DE ALTO DESEMPENHO (SSCAD), 13. , 2012, Petrópolis. Anais [...]. Porto Alegre: Sociedade Brasileira de Computação, 2012 . p. 57-64.